About 01 Numbers
These digits are linked with specific locations in the UK and are commonly used by domestic and commercial premises. Also known as as 'basic rate', 'local rate', or 'national rate' numbers, the costs for these geographic numbers are predicated on the time of day. Most service providers offer call packages that allow free calls during designated times. Call costs from mobile phones are based on the chosen calling plan, with a lot of plans incorporating these numbers in their free call packages.
